NFIB “Mood On Main Street Darkens” Small Business Optimism Dips

NFIB “Mood On Main Street Darkens” Small Business Optimism Dips

Image Source: PexelsThe July jump in small business optimism momentum lasted precisely one month.Small Business Optimism Dips in AugustThe NFIB reports Small Business Optimism Dips in August The NFIB Small Business Optimism Index fell by 2.5 points in August to 91.2, erasing all of July’s gain. This is the 32nd consecutive month below the 50-year average of 98. Academy Sports + Outdoors Reports Mixed Q2 Results

Academy Sports + Outdoors Reports Mixed Q2 Results

Academy Sports + Outdoors (ASOas) recently released its financial results for the second quarter of 2024, revealing a mixed performance. The company’s net sales declined by 2.2%, while comparable sales saw a sharper drop of 6.9%. Despite these declines, the company reported a GAAP diluted earnings per share (EPS) of $1.95.
